smoking;; Mark Morford

ESSENTIAL Mark Morford columns:

Give It Up, Smoker 08.April.09
Death, cancer, rotted teeth, emphysema won't do it, but 62 cents will?

and his earlier (2005) column of the same topic:
Dead People Smoke Camels
Quit smoking the EZ way! Pop this new drug, ignore your real issues. God bless America.
It seems obvious but it bears repeating: magic-bullet drugs do nothing. They do nothing to help you change a thing about your addictive tendencies or your attitude or your lifestyle, do nothing to induce any sort of increase in your understanding of how the body works and how the spirit is screaming for attention and just why the hell you might be so easily prone to addiction in the first place. Such prescription drugs don't educate. They don't invoke change. They just numb.

But hell, who cares? Why examine causes? Why try to figure out the reasons behind our toxic tendencies and our weird obsession with things we know are killing us? Simply bomb the problem into submission, and then pretend it's not still right there, simmering just underneath, even nastier and more fanged than before and just aching to manifest itself in some other form. Ain't that America? You're goddamn right it is.

The true punster’s mind cycles through homophones in search of a quip the way small children delight in rhymes or experiment babblingly with language. Accordingly, the least intolerable puns are those that avoid the pun’s essential puerility. Richard Whately, Archbishop of Dublin, was a specialist. He could effortlessly execute the double pun: Noah’s Ark was made of gopher-wood, he would say, but Joan of Arc was maid of Orleans. Some Whately-isms are so complex that they nearly amount to honest jokes: Why can a man never starve in the Great Desert? Because he can eat the sand which is there. But what brought the sandwiches there? Why, Noah sent Ham, and his descendants mustered and bred.

Pun for the Ages, NYtimes
